"Commuter" Trains
A very annoying media habit is referring to Intercity Trains as "Commuter Trains". Yesterday, according to the Indo, a woman had a baby on a Galway-Dublin "commuter" train and men were arrested for snorting cocaine (a.k.a. doing a Michael Gove) on a Dublin-Cork "commuter" train.
